See one of the most famous road junctions in the world. Piccadilly Circus was originally built in 1819 to connect Regent Street with Piccadilly and today lies at the intersection of five main roads: Regent Street, Shaftesbury Avenue, Piccadilly Street, Covent Street and Haymarket. It is a popular meeting place and tourist attraction that is surrounded by the London Pavilion, Criterion Restaurant and Criterion Theatre. At the center of the Circus is the Shaftesbury Memorial Fountain, built in 1893 to commemorate Lord Shaftesbury, a philanthropist known for his support of the poor.
